NEW OUTDOOR WARNING SIREN INSTALLATION COMPLETED
Funding was provided by Homeland Security through Prowers County Office of Emergency Management for the installation of a new outdoor warning siren in the northwest quadrant of the City of Lamar.  The location and coordination with the City of Lamar Light and Power and local electrician, Electra Pro, made this project possible and on January 4th 2021 the siren operated flawlessly during its 1st test. This and all other sirens in Lamar, Granada, Wiley and Hartman are tested on the 1st Monday of every month in Prowers County.

With assistance from a Homeland Security Grant Prowers County Office of Emergency Management has the capability of on scene incident management.  The unit is self contained with 8 positions, 800 Mhz and wireless communications availability.  The unit was activated for the Holly Tornado in 2007.

Prowers County Office of Emergency Management Mass Care trailer provides the capability to provide mass care supplies for 150.  Items such as cots, blankets and pillows were obtained from a packaged disaster hospital that the county down sized in 1997.  The same items have been pre-positioned in the Towns of Granada and Holly which provided useful in past winter weather events.
